Northrop Grumman's Corporate Asset Services team is seeking an experienced IT Asset Management (ITAM) Analyst to oversee and manage the lifecycle of IT Assets within classified environments. The ideal candidate will be adept at asset tracking and reporting in secure environments and will demonstrate proactive stewardship of all hardware and software assets.  The ITAM analyst will ensure compliance with policies and procedures to optimize asset utilization and minimize risks. Please note that the selected candidate will be required to work on-site, full-time, at our Linthicum, MD or Annapolis Junction, MD campus - this is not a remote work opportunity.

Responsibilities will include but not be limited to the following:

  • Maintain accurate inventory of all IT assets (hardware, software, peripheral devices).

  • Track asset lifecycle from acquisition to decommission in accordance with policies.

  • Ensure proper labeling, logging, and disposal of assets and components.

  • Coordinate with security, facilities, and IT Teams to support secure asset movement and installations.

  • Conduct regular audits and reconciliation to verify asset data accuracy and compliance.

  • Identify cost-saving opportunities and optimize asset utilization.

  • Manage asset records in the enterprise asset management system.

  • Provide guidance to technical teams on classified asset handling procedures and best practices.

  • Respond to incident investigations or data calls involving assets in the environment.

  • Participate and support Configuration Management and Change control boards when asset changes are involved.
